4.The circular areas represents areas of tall trees that Mother wished to have and would correspond to the parts of the "outer" gardens that are now under planting.
Do let me know your further thoughts on this. Those who feel the mountain in the south-east had very good reasons. They feel that since that is the highest point, some 3/4 meters above the south-western side, it is the natural site for the mountain. Secondly, if a water storage area is to be build within the mountain, the extra elevation would provide that much more gravity feed. They are good reasons but I feel not sufficiently strong enough to counter the importance of the impression of first seeing the Matrimandir without anything to distract the eye.
